//-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
// Samy Kamkar, 2011, 2012
// Brad antoniewicz 2011
// Christian Herrmann, 2017
//
// This code is licensed to you under the terms of the GNU GPL, version 2 or,
// at your option, any later version. See the LICENSE.txt file for the text of
// the license.
//-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
// main code for LF aka Proxbrute by Brad antoniewicz
//-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
#include "standalone.h" // standalone definitions
#include "proxmark3_arm.h"
#include "appmain.h"
#include "fpgaloader.h"
#include "util.h"
#include "dbprint.h"
#include "ticks.h"
#include "lfops.h"
#define OPTS 2
void ModInfo(void) {
DbpString(" LF HID ProxII bruteforce - aka Proxbrute (Brad Antoniewicz)");
}
// samy's sniff and repeat routine for LF
void RunMod() {
StandAloneMode();
Dbprintf(">> LF HID proxII bruteforce a.k.a ProxBrute Started (Brad Antoniewicz) <<");
FpgaDownloadAndGo(FPGA_BITSTREAM_LF);
uint32_t high[OPTS], low[OPTS];
int selected = 0;
int playing = 0;
int cardRead = 0;
// Turn on selected LED
LED(selected + 1, 0);
for (;;) {
WDT_HIT();
// exit from SamyRun, send a usbcommand.
if (data_available()) break;
// Was our button held down or pressed?
int button_pressed = BUTTON_HELD(1000);
SpinDelay(300);
// Button was held for a second, begin recording
if (button_pressed > 0 && cardRead == 0) {
LEDsoff();
LED(selected + 1, 0);
LED(LED_D, 0);
// record
DbpString("[=] starting recording");
// wait for button to be released
while (BUTTON_PRESS())
WDT_HIT();
/* need this delay to prevent catching some weird data */
SpinDelay(500);
CmdHIDdemodFSK(1, &high[selected], &low[selected], 0);
Dbprintf("[=] recorded %x %x %08x", selected, high[selected], low[selected]);
LEDsoff();
LED(selected + 1, 0);
// Finished recording
// If we were previously playing, set playing off
// so next button push begins playing what we recorded
playing = 0;
cardRead = 1;
} else if (button_pressed > 0 && cardRead == 1) {
LEDsoff();
LED(selected + 1, 0);
LED(LED_A, 0);
// record
Dbprintf("[=] cloning %x %x %08x", selected, high[selected], low[selected]);
// wait for button to be released
while (BUTTON_PRESS())
WDT_HIT();
/* need this delay to prevent catching some weird data */
SpinDelay(500);
CopyHIDtoT55x7(0, high[selected], low[selected], 0);
Dbprintf("[=] cloned %x %x %08x", selected, high[selected], low[selected]);
LEDsoff();
LED(selected + 1, 0);
// Finished recording
// If we were previously playing, set playing off
// so next button push begins playing what we recorded
playing = 0;
cardRead = 0;
}
// Change where to record (or begin playing)
else if (button_pressed) {
// Next option if we were previously playing
if (playing)
selected = (selected + 1) % OPTS;
playing = !playing;
LEDsoff();
LED(selected + 1, 0);
// Begin transmitting
if (playing) {
LED(LED_B, 0);
DbpString("[=] playing");
// wait for button to be released
while (BUTTON_PRESS())
WDT_HIT();
/* START PROXBRUTE */
/*
ProxBrute - brad a. - foundstone
Following code is a trivial brute forcer once you read a valid tag
the idea is you get a valid tag, then just try and brute force to
another priv level. The problem is that it has no idea if the code
worked or not, so its a crap shoot. One option is to time how long
it takes to get a valid ID then start from scratch every time.
*/
if (selected == 1) {
DbpString("[=] entering ProxBrute Mode");
Dbprintf("[=] current Tag: Selected = %x Facility = %08x ID = %08x", selected, high[selected], low[selected]);
LED(LED_A, 0);
LED(LED_C, 0);
for (uint16_t i = low[selected] - 1; i > 0; i--) {
if (BUTTON_PRESS()) {
DbpString("[-] told to stop");
break;
}
Dbprintf("[=] trying Facility = %08x ID %08x", high[selected], i);
CmdHIDsimTAGEx(high[selected], i, 0, 20000);
SpinDelay(500);
}
} else {
DbpString("[=] RED is lit, not entering ProxBrute Mode");
Dbprintf("[=] %x %x %x", selected, high[selected], low[selected]);
CmdHIDsimTAGEx(high[selected], low[selected], 0, 20000);
DbpString("[=] done playing");
}
/* END PROXBRUTE */
if (BUTTON_HELD(1000) > 0)
goto out;
/* We pressed a button so ignore it here with a delay */
SpinDelay(300);
// when done, we're done playing, move to next option
selected = (selected + 1) % OPTS;
playing = !playing;
LEDsoff();
LED(selected + 1, 0);
} else {
while (BUTTON_PRESS())
WDT_HIT();
}
}
}
out:
DbpString("[=] exiting");
LEDsoff();
}
